Need sugestions for a new Cam
I need a new cam, I think. I'm looking for some more power at 20 psi.
Right now I have a 224/224 with .580 lift and 115lsa with no advance ground in. My current effective RPM range is 5200-6200 with a pretty rapid drop off in power after that. The Engine is a 370", 9:1 cr, forged block and AFR 225 heads. The Turbo system is a Cutsom Single with 1.75" tubular headers. The Turbo is a Turbonetics 82-83mm, Ball bearing, and the new "F1" T4 exhaust housing (w/1.01 a/r).
I am thinking that the cam may be holding me back a little. I think if I can move the PB up about 500 rpm we'll see abit more power (its just over 800rwhp now). I'd like to see 850-900 ish with a cam swap.
